I had my band in 2008, just had it out 7/8/15 along with hernia repair and revision to sleeve. The surgeon told my husband that he removed a lot of scar tissue. My pain was mostly between the two largest incisions,had only the IV Tylenol in the hospital no narcotics...did use the Tylenol with Codeine at home.Id say about the same pain as when the band was put in.

Everyone has different pain levels, I do feel so much better with the band out....so worth it!

Mine was put in in 2007 also and I had it removed last year. I would say it was about the same as when it was put in or when I had my gall bladder removed. Just some stomach pain around the biggest incision but nothing the pain meds didn't take care of. I evidently didn't have much scar tissue altho it sure felt like it and according to my surgical report there was some. I sure did feel better tho once it was out. It had been causing a horrible pain for months up under my rib cage. Felt like an ice pick jammed up under the middle of my rib cage! As soon as I woke up from surgery it was gone! I felt like a new person. hooray!!
